AMFS recently treated 100,000 gallons of PFAS- and PFOA-contaminated water stored in an underground storage tank at a mission-critical U.S. Air Force Base. Using an advanced permanent RO membrane filter, AMFS processed the fluid at a rate of 43,000 gallons per day. Test results confirmed that PFOA, PFOS, GENX, PFHxS, PFNA, and PFBS were all reduced to non-detection levels.
